Q: Is 10,196,116 a Prime Number?
A: No, 10,196,116 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 10196116 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 7 14 28 49 98 196 52,021 104,042 208,084 364,147 728,294 1,456,588 2,549,029 5,098,058 and 10,196,116, with no remainder.
Since 10,196,116 cannot be divided by just 1 and 10,196,116, it is not a prime number.
